Comprehending the Goethe B1 Exam
The Goethe B1 exam evaluates language efficiency throughout four crucial areas: listening, reading, composing, and speaking. These aspects come together to paint a detailed image of a prospect's language abilities.
Exam StructureAreaPeriodAbilities AssessedListening30 minComprehension of spoken German in everyday contextsChecking out65 minutesComprehending composed texts, including short articles and emailsWriting60 minAbility to produce coherent texts, such as letters and reportsSpeaking15 minutesPractical speaking ability in conversational settingsExam Objectives

What is the passing rating for the Goethe B1 exam?
The passing rating is generally around 60%. Nevertheless, this might differ depending on specific screening conditions.
2. How long is the Goethe B1 certificate valid?
The Goethe B1 certificate does not expire and functions as an important credential for educational and expert purposes.
3. Is prior understanding of German needed for B1?
Yes, prospects need to have a standard understanding of German to successfully get ready for and take the B1 exam. It is typically anticipated that students take an A2 exam before trying B1.
4. Can I retake the exam if I do not hand down the first attempt?
Yes, prospects can retake the exam as often times as needed to achieve the preferred efficiency level.
5. What are the benefits of getting the Goethe B1 certificate?
The Goethe B1 certificate can be helpful for instructional opportunities, employment prospects in German-speaking countries, and self-assessment of language abilities.
